I get knocked out 70% of the time vs. stupid/bad beats.

Would you include this hand in the 70%? You were ahead when you put in 90 chips and behind when you put in 2910. Bad play, not bad beat

You may be tearing it up at Foxwoods, but if you are betting 3K chips to win 300 or so (1/10 odds) you clearly have no understanding or feel for the game.

BrentD22 said:
I'm going to down load all my tournaments on pokertracker and post them here so you can all see how friggin unlucky I am.

You could do, but when you accept that you are losing hands and tournaments (it's lose and losing, not loose and loosing by the way ;)) due to bad play and not bad luck you will hopefully improve your play dramatically, and you'll enjoy it more.
